Abstract: Caching at mobile edge servers can smooth temporal traffic variability and reduce the service load of base stations in mobile video delivery. However, the assignment of multiple video representations to distributed servers is still a challenging question in the context of adaptive streaming, since any two representations from different videos or even from the same video will compete for the limited caching storage. Therefore, it is important, yet challenging, to optimally select the cached representations for each edge server in order to effectively reduce the service load of base station while maintaining a high quality of experience (QoE) for users. To address this, we study a QoE-driven mobile edge caching placement optimization problem for dynamic adaptive video streaming that properly takes into account the different rate-distortion (R–D) characteristics of videos and the coordination among distributed edge servers. Then, by the optimal caching placement of representations for multiple videos, we maximize the aggregate average video distortion reduction of all users while minimizing the additional cost of representation downloading from the base station, subject not only to the storage capacity constraints of the edge servers, but also to the transmission and initial startup delay constraints of the users. We formulate the proposed optimization problem as an integer linear program to provide the performance upper bound, and as a submodular maximization problem with a set of knapsack constraints to develop a practically feasible cost benefit greedy algorithm. The proposed algorithm has polynomial computational complexity and a theoretical lower bound on its performance. Simulation results further show that the proposed algorithm is able to achieve a near-optimal performance with very low time complexity. Abstract: Methods and systems are provided for reducing interference across coverage cells using base stations interconnected by a packet network. A wireless device monitors the channel signal strength of its serving cell and its neighboring cell (902). The serving cell collects measurements from the wireless devices within its cell (904, 906) and informs its neighboring cell when one of the wireless devices may be causing significant interference to the neighboring cell (910). The neighboring cell collects this information (912) and executes a multi-user detection and cancellation algorithm on a subset of these interfering wireless devices.

Abstract: Operational tests and demonstrations of systems based on software radios are currently being performed in the 800 MHz mobile cellular radio band. These field trials are for mobile unit geolocation systems and adaptive phased array "smart antenna" applications. The geolocation system trials are in response to the demand for high confidence geolocation of mobile units for enhanced emergency 911 service and for use in the US Department of Transportation's Intelligent Vehicle Highway System (NHS) initiative. The smart antenna array application addresses the cellular service providers' need for more user channel capacity and/or geographic coverage from existing base station installations. Software radio architectures were selected because of their ability to provide superior performance at low life cycle cost. These systems use 4 to 8 wideband coherent channels and fully characterize the arriving RF energy to either geolocate the emitter or to maximize the carrier-to-interference ratio. >

Abstract: A method and system for providing a reliable means to perform handoff from a code division multiple access (CDMA) system using a pilot signal to an alternative access communication technique system. Simple pilot box circuitry is added to a set of border base stations. The border base stations are base stations which operate only in the alternative access communication technique and which have coverage areas which are contiguous with coverage areas of CDMA operation base stations. The mobile unit monitors for the pilot signal from the border base stations in the same manner as it monitors for pilot signals from the CDMA operation base stations. When the mobile unit detects the pilot signal corresponding to a border base station, it notifies a system controller in accordance with standard operation. The system controller is aware that the pilot signal corresponds to a border base station and thus triggers a hard handoff process to the alternative access communication technique system in response thereto.
